Sharpe reportedly will sign two-year, $12-million deal with Nets
Former North Carolina center Day’Ron Sharpe will sign a two-year, $12-million deal to return to the Brooklyn Nets, according to a Monday afternoon report from ESPN’s Shams Charania. This comes one day after the news that Brooklyn didn’t tender qualifying offers to Sharpe and Ziaire Williams, making both unrestricted free agents.
